Title:
HEAT MANAGEMENT SYSTEM FOR VEHICLE

Abstract:
The present invention is provided with: a first refrigerant circuit 1 for cabin-interior air conditioning, which has a first refrigerant/internal air heat exchanger 12 for exchanging heat between a first refrigerant and indoor air; a cooling water circuit 2 for cooling an electrical component 23 with cooling water; a second refrigerant circuit 3 for battery temperature regulation, which has a battery heat exchanger 38 for exchanging heat between a second refrigerant and a battery; a first refrigerant/cooling water heat exchanger 4; and, a second refrigerant/cooling water heat exchanger 5. In a mode for battery cooling and cooling water heat storage activated during charging of the battery, the second refrigerant absorbs heat from the battery in the battery heat exchanger and dissipates heat to the cooling water in the second refrigerant/cooling water heat exchanger to maintain the temperature of the cooling water within a prescribed range in the cooling water circuit 2. In the first refrigerant circuit in a cabin interior heating mode, the first refrigerant absorbs heat from the cooling water in the first refrigerant/cooling water heat exchanger 4 and dissipates heat to indoor air in the first refrigerant/internal air heat exchanger 12.
